Been thinking about creating stronger relationships with centers of influence. Currently mine include venture capitalists, attorneys, and accountants. What motivates these people to give referrals?

VC invest $ in companies and get a premium return for the risk. Not likely to ride out mutual funds or ETFs except in a 401k or DB Cash balance plan for tax purposes..

like

Reciprocation and trust that you will handle their client/referral as well as they would. Show em the 5 step process. Boom!
